1. Key Features to Look For
When picking out walking flip-flops, keep these things in mind:
Arch Support
- Good Arch Support: This is super important. It helps your foot stay in its natural shape. It can stop your feet from getting tired or sore.
- Contoured Footbed: A footbed that matches the shape of your foot feels much better. It gives your heel and arch a place to rest.
Cushioning
- Plenty of Cushioning: Soft soles absorb shock. This protects your feet and joints from hard surfaces. Think of it like walking on clouds!
- Shock Absorption: Good cushioning means less jolt with every step. This is key for comfort on longer walks.
Strap Comfort
- Soft, Wide Straps: Thin, rough straps can rub and cause blisters. Soft, wider straps spread the pressure evenly.
- Adjustable Straps: Some flip-flops have straps you can adjust. This helps you get the perfect fit.
Sole Grip
- Non-Slip Sole: You want a sole that grips the ground. This stops you from slipping, especially on wet surfaces.
- Durable Sole: A strong sole lasts longer. It won’t wear out too quickly from walking.
2. Important Materials
The stuff your flip-flops are made of matters a lot.
Footbed Materials
- EVA Foam: This is a common material. It’s lightweight and offers good cushioning.
- Cork: Cork is a natural material. It’s supportive and molds to your foot over time. It’s also good at absorbing moisture.
- Memory Foam: This foam bounces back. It gives you a soft, custom fit that supports your feet.
Strap Materials
- Soft Rubber: This is flexible and gentle on the skin.
- Fabric-Lined Materials: Some straps have a soft fabric lining. This prevents rubbing.
- Leather: Leather can be soft and durable. It often looks more stylish, too.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: What are the main key features I should look for in women’s flip-flops for walking?
A: You should look for good arch support, a contoured footbed, plenty of cushioning, soft and wide straps, and a non-slip, durable sole.
Q: What materials are best for the footbed of walking flip-flops?
A: EVA foam, cork, and memory foam are excellent choices for footbeds because they offer cushioning and support.
Q: How do strap materials affect the quality and comfort?
A: Soft rubber, fabric-lined materials, or soft leather straps are best. They prevent rubbing and blisters, unlike stiff or thin straps.
Q: Can flip-flops really provide good support for walking?
A: Yes, if they have features like arch support and a contoured footbed, some flip-flops are designed specifically for walking and offer good support.
Q: What makes a flip-flop of lower quality for walking?
A: Thin, hard soles, stiff straps, and cheap plastic materials reduce quality and comfort for walking.
Q: Are flip-flops good for long walks?
A: While some are designed for walking, traditional flip-flops are generally not recommended for very long walks. Look for specific walking styles with excellent support.
Q: How can I tell if a flip-flop has enough cushioning?
A: You can usually feel the cushioning by pressing down on the sole. A softer, more giving sole indicates better cushioning.
Q: What is a contoured footbed?
A: A contoured footbed is shaped to match the natural curves of your foot, providing support to your arch and heel.
Q: Can flip-flops help with foot pain like plantar fasciitis?
A: Yes, flip-flops with good arch support and cushioning can help alleviate pain from conditions like plantar fasciitis.
Q: How should I care for my walking flip-flops?
A: Most walking flip-flops can be cleaned with mild soap and water. Always check the manufacturer’s instructions for specific care.
